    Why is Scarlett Johansson Suing Disney?

    Scarlett Johansson, star of the latest Marvel movie “Black Widow,” filed a lawsuit in Los Angeles Superior Court against Disney, alleging her contract was breached when the media company released the film on its Disney+ streaming service at the same time as its theatrical debut.

    The suit claims that her agreement with Disney’s Marvel Entertainment guaranteed an exclusive theatrical release, and her salary was based in large part on the films performance at the Box Office.

    Jay-Z Auctions off NFT of "Reasonable Doubt" Cover Art

    This is a follow up to a recent episode about how Roc-A-Fella Records has sued its co-founder, Damon Dash, for allegedly trying to mint and sell the copyright ownership for Jay-Z’s 1996 debut album Reasonable Doubt as a non-fungible token. According to the complaint Dash had started the process of and began to promote the sell of an NFT of the Reasonable Doubt copyright at an auction on the platform SuperFarm, which was set to take place June 23rd through 25th. A judge has ruled in favor of Roc-A-Fella Records and prohibited Damon Dash from minting and selling Jay-Z’s Reasonable Doubt as a non-fungible token.   

    Jay-Z recently Auctioned off an NFT of the Cover Art for his 1996 Debut Album "Reasonable Doubt" as an NFT.
